你好呀!我是小易同学,一名普通的不能再普通的学习者。
写文章是为了记录自己的学习过程,同时也希望能帮助到需要的人。
如果我的文章对您有帮助,请不要忘记关注我哦🥰
前言
相信大家都有在GitHub上寻找过想要研究一下的项目,但常常却浪费了大把的时间,最后找到的项目不尽人意。那么,我们可以怎样高效快速地寻找到自己想要的项目呢。
提示:以下是本篇文章正文内容
**
一
、项目详情页介绍**
我们打开任意一个项目,一般都是如下图这样的界面,其中包括项目名字,项目描述,项目更新时间等信息。
这些信息即是对开源项目的详细描述,也是你查找开源项目的重要信息。
二、使用关键词快速高效查找项目
1.常用搜索关键词
常用搜索关键词
language:xxx编程语言为xxxin:name xxx按照项目名/仓库名搜索(大小写不敏感)in:description xxx按照项目描述搜索stars:>xxx按stars数量大于多少搜索forks:>xxx按照forks数大于多少搜索in:readme xxx按照README搜索(大小写不敏感)created:>YYYY-MM-DD按照创建时间大于YYYY-MM-DD搜索pushed:>YYYY-MM-DD按照最新更新时间晚于YYYY-MM-DD
想看更多命令可参考:Searching for repositories - GitHub Docs
2.示例
2.1.你搜索项目的方式是不是这样?直接在搜索框输入自己想找的项目
可以看到这一共有15478个项目,这样就太杂乱了,有Java语言的项目,还有JavaScript语言的项目。那我们如何筛选呢?
2.2.根据语言筛选(language:xxx)
现在我们看到只有2749个项目了,很明显都是Java语言的项目。
2.3.根据stars数判断项目受不受欢迎(stars:>1000)
对于一个开源项目受不受欢迎的最重要指标之一就是项目的star数了,现在我们看到只有10个项目了,很明显都是很受欢迎的项目。
如果我的文章对您有帮助,请不要忘记关注我哦🥰
版权归原作者 小易同学go 所有, 如有侵权,请联系我们删除。